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 18 Minutes |
Ready In: 38 Minutes Servings: 12 |
|
A quick and easy version of your favorite caramel roll! Ooey and Gooey! Ingredients:
1/4 cup butter, melted |
3 tablespoons sugar |
3 tablespoons firmly packed brown sugar |
3 tablespoons light corn syrup |
1/4 cup chopped pecans |
1 tablespoon sugar |
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on |
2 tablespoons butter, softened |
1 (11 ounce) can refrigerated breadstick dough |
Directions:
1. Heat oven to 375°. Combine all topping ingredients except pecans in 9-inch round cake pan; stir until well mixed. Sprinkle with pecans. Set aside. 2. Combine 1 tablespoon sugar and cinnamon in small bowl. Set aside. 3. Unroll dough; separate into 12 strips. Spread each strip with melted butter; sprinkle evenly with sugar-cinnamon mixture. Roll up loosely. Pinch seam to seal. Place rolls evenly in pan. 4. Bake for 18 to 23 minutes or until golden brown. Cool 5 minutes. Invert onto serving platter. Let stand 1 minute before removing pan. Serve warm. |
